After some Years of using and replacing the battery, my Kindle Paperwhite 2nd generation still works fine. But its casing got very sticky by the dissolving soft coating. So I made a new casing. You disassemble the Paperwhite by peeling off the front (it's glued to the screen). Under it you find eleven screws, that hold the screen in the casing. After unscrewing you have to recover the tiny nuts from their sockets in the casing to insert them in the screwholes of the newly printet casing. I heated up the old casing to loosen the nuts from their sockets.Use a small plier or similar. I used PLA. Tree-support for the holes in the Frame. Button didn't need support. Designed with FreeCAD.
